3-8 Harness check Mode

By selecting Other menu and Circuit check Engine stop, the present conditions of the harness connector
can be checked (See fig. below.).
When the Circuit check Engine stop is selected, the message "Checking touch harness" will appear at the
moment the engine revolution drops below 800 rpm. This mode is available on the condition that the engine
is stopped. The mode cannot be selected when the engine revolution is 800 rpm or over.
While in harness check mode, the following items can be checked. Items in parentheses are error criteria.
• Lever lock switch (OFF When lever is down).
• Fuel sensor (Reading of 2 V or more, or 0.2 V or less.).
• Water temperature (Water temperature of 140 C or more, or -30 C or lower.).
• Oil switch (OFF When engine stops and Key is ON).
• Charge circuit (OFF).
If there is any error, a message indicating the position of the error will flash automatically. Simultaneously,
the buzzer will beep.
When the error is restored, the buzzer will be turned OFF, but the flashing memory will be kept on hold.
If there are a number of errors, the screen will scroll.
